Interpreting Off-Road Rubber Markings
Navigating challenging terrain with your vehicle requires more than just a powerful engine; it demands the right footwear. But simply grabbing the most aggressive-looking unit isn’t enough. Knowing the numbers and letters stamped on the sidewall – the off-road rubber markings – is essential for selecting a set that matches your driving style and the conditions you’ll encounter. These markings offer a wealth of information, including rubber size, load capacity, speed rating, and much more. For case, a code like "LT275/70R17" tells you the footwear is a light truck tire, 275 millimeters wide, with an aspect ratio of 70%, mounted on a 17-inch diameter. Moreover, symbols show things like slush and snow suitability or three-peak mountain snowflake certification. Taking the time to study what these markings mean will significantly improve your off-road experience and ensure a more secure adventure.
Interpreting Your Farm Tire Size
Determining the correct tire measurement for your agricultural can seem challenging at first glance, but a little information goes a long way. Tire dimensions are typically presented as a series of numbers and letters that contain critical details. For instance, a common marking might be 11.2R32. The '11.2' indicates the tire's width in inches. The 'R' signifies a radial ply construction, a standard type for modern tractors. Finally, the '32' indicates the rim size in inches. Precisely reading these codes is essential to guarantee best performance, well-being, and durability of your tractor tires. Ignoring these requirements can lead to reduced traction, premature tire damage, and even likely equipment harm.
